Output 3d4f964b05049d31a16e149b2fb1d893ca8e35d2667fa1ac4e8ae13fbbafc6eb:0

value
475808996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5027381805fd963e29e57628275415d8e973d3bc OP_EQUALVERIFY OP_CHECKSIG
address
DCSuaba75xhAfKN6VktxYjCF2BQ2Vmxztb
transaction
3d4f964b05049d31a16e149b2fb1d893ca8e35d2667fa1ac4e8ae13fbbafc6eb